The arid climate and significant temperature swings between day and night can cause wood to expand and contract. We recommend using stable materials like plywood boxes with solid wood faces, or considering moisture-resistant options, and ensuring finishes are well-sealed to prevent drying and cracking. Proper acclimation of materials to your home's interior for several days before installation is crucial here.
From measurement to final installation, a typical kitchen project takes 4-8 weeks, with installation itself lasting 3-5 days. Seasonal considerations are important; winter can delay deliveries from major suppliers due to mountain road conditions, while late summer is the peak season for local contractors, so booking early is advised.
For simple replacement installations, a permit is often not required. However, if your project involves moving plumbing, electrical, or altering load-bearing walls, you must check with the Jemez Pueblo Tribal Administration Office and potentially the Pueblo's Housing Authority. It's always best to hire a contractor familiar with local tribal and county (Sandoval) regulations.
Prioritize contractors with verifiable local references and experience working in the area's unique adobe or conventional frame homes. Ensure they are licensed, insured, and understand the logistical challenges of serving our rural community. A reputable installer will offer a detailed, written estimate and timeline specific to your project.
It's very common to discover walls and floors that are not level or square, especially in older adobe or traditional homes. This requires skilled shimming and customization during installation. We also frequently find outdated wiring or plumbing behind old cabinets, so budgeting a contingency (10-15%) for such unforeseen repairs is wise.
